The net present value of the loan vs paying as you go might be informative for you. The NPV calculation is used to calculate the return of an investment, generally CAPEX, but it works perfectly here because your education is an investment. Plenty of online resources and calculators, excel has the functions built in as well.

Basically, you calculate the expected costs each way - paying cash as you go, earning a lower salary for x years and the discount rate / cost of capital vs taking a loan, not having income due to full time school, and quicker path to higher salary. If it’s positive your best bet is flight school full time, if it’s negative then pay as you go. If it’s roughly zero, it’s even money either way. FWIW - I use 5% as my personal discount rate.

We have a mix of whole and term life. Term is primarily to replace income and whole life is to pay final expenses, leave some cash behind, etc. I make $200k and have $1.9m in insurance, $1.5 is term the rest is whole life. My wife has $750k in insurance and earns $80k annually. We don’t have mortgage protection insurance, it’s built into the amounts we have already.

All of our kids have a $50k whole life policy that can be increased up to $250k without any additional medical exams. Just took out a policy on our first grandchild too.

Send them a certified letter asking them for copies of all of the supporting paperwork. Rental contract (both check out and check in) damage reports from the company, body shop estimates, police reports (assuming accident), repairs receipts, etc.

You want all of it returned certified mail in 30 days for your attorney to review. It’s on them to validate the debt not on you to prove it’s not yours.

If you do this within 30 days of first contacting you, I believe they are required by law (FDCPA) to cease collection efforts until they have validated the debt is yours.
